Ghoul and Glory Sea of Thieves Event – All Rewards

sea of thieves reputation
Image Source: Rare

Ghoul and Glory lasts from October 27th to November 1st. The event is merely a Halloween tradition. So, there’s nothing you really have to do but log in and play the game normally. The rewards consist of earning double the amount of the following:

  • Allegiance
  • Gold
  • Renown
  • Reputation

There’s also a Pirate Emporium sale going on alongside the event. If you want to buy Halloween-themed items for less, like the Jack O’ Looter costume, now’s the time to check out the shop.

Best Gold Methods

Gold is always important to gain, and now’s a great time to do it. If you want to take advantage of the double gold opportunity before the Sea of Thieves event concludes, it’s time to start farming.

Although there are numerous ways to earn gold, we want to stick with the ones that will get you a lot in a short amount of time. This way, you can better utilize the opportunity. One good feature to use is the Emissary Flag. These flags already increase your earnings, and with the double gold during the Sea of Thieves Ghoul and Glory event, you can see it perhaps tripled.

Another solid approach is to go at it solo with the Sea Forts. They’re not tough either, so you can manage several before the end of the event. Working with the right Trading Company also helps farm gold, as they’ll send you on worthwhile voyages to return with large amounts of treasure.

How To Get the Rapier of the Damned

rapier of the damned
Image Source: Rare via The Nerd Stash

Are you looking to complete the Damned Set? Thanks to the Ghoul and Glory event, you can earn the Rapier of the Damned and round out the haunting Sea of Thieves cosmetic set.

Similar to earning double gold, Allegiance, etc., you don’t have to do anything unique to earn the cutlass. It’s considered a freebie. All that’s needed is for you to log in during the time period we mentioned earlier. Logging in will automatically reward you with the Rapier of the Damned and a Legendary Search to find the Skull of Destiny Voyage.
